Kansiottiedostotxt is a descriptive term used in Finnish computing contexts to refer to a plain text file that inventories the folders (kansiot) and files (tiedostot) within a project or filesystem. It is not a formal standard, but a label that may appear in documentation, sample data, or automation scripts.
